Abstract

In distribution centers, some orders may not be fulfilled due to the shortage of inventory. We consider the case where an order is picked and shipped only when all items in the order is available in the inventory; and the unfulfilled orders are transferred to the next day with higher priority. Given daily inventory and a set of orders arrived during a day, the problem is to assign the inventory to the orders so as to maximize the order fill rate (OFR). We formulate this problem as a linear programming problem. We also consider the weighted OFR to reflect the importance of each order. Simulation results indicate that the proposed LP approach outperforms the existing simple rules; and, more importantly, the improvement ratio increases as the number of items and/or orders increases.
